2. Dyson remains to be on the reducing fringe of innovation
There’s loads of copycatting occurring in vacuum cleaner land, however Dyson nonetheless has some options that nobody has managed to duplicate.
The most effective instance right here is the laser constructed into its Fluffy floorheads. The cleaner head shoots out a exactly angled beam of sunshine to forged large shadows on even tiny specs of mud on exhausting flooring, highlighting simply how a lot you are lacking in your cleansing runs. It is a uncommon case of one thing that each sounds extremely cool and in addition occurs to be genuinely helpful.
A lot of manufacturers have fitted headlamps onto their vacuums, however they’re actually very totally different to Dyson’s lasers in observe. These LED lights merely brighten dingy corners of carpet, which might be pretty useful, however they’re unlikely that will help you spot something smaller than a cornflake.
One other nice innovation is the particle dimension counter that seems within the V15 Detect and Gen5detect, the place you may see precisely what’s being sucked up as you go about your cleansing. Loads of manufacturers supply automated suction adjustment, however Dyson is the one one to point out you precisely what is going on on below the hood, in a colourful and nicely-presented bar graph. Whether or not this function is strictly obligatory is one other matter.

4… however they don’t seem to be probably the most comfy to make use of
Generally, I believe Dyson has prioritized cutting-edge options and superior tech on the expense of consolation and usefulness. They appear to be getting ever heavier – the model redesigned the motor and improved the battery for the most recent Gen5, and whereas the suction and runtimes are glorious, the payoff is that the hand-held unit is noticeably very heavy for a stick vacuum. A lot so, it could be a deal-breaker for some folks.
The Dyson V11 and newer fashions are organized with the wand, motor and mud cup in a straight line, for optimum suction effectivity. The draw back is that the filter and motor casing tasks out above the deal with and might press awkwardly in your hand and arm as you clear. In favor of cleaner traces, the deal with is not ergonomically formed both; I used to be significantly struck by this when evaluating the Samsung Bespoke AI Jet Extremely vs Dyson Gen5detect.
Nevertheless, the factor that annoys me most about Dyson’s vacuums is that lots of them nonetheless have set off operation with no lock for steady operating. The model has solved the problem with the most recent fashions (the Gen5detect and V12 Detect Slim each change on and off with a one-press button), however there are nonetheless loads of older choices within the present vary that require you to awkwardly maintain down a set off the entire time you are cleansing.
5. The cleansing energy is far of a muchness
Whereas Dyson’s vacuums may technically be extra environment friendly, and supply extra suction, on check we discover lots of vacuums supply an identical stage of cleansing energy in observe. So if you get it into your own home, you may discover your flooring look simply as clear after utilizing a mega-bucks Dyson as they’d have finished with, say, a Dreame R20 or Shark Detect Professional Cordless. Except you are coping with excessive volumes of filth or deep pile carpets as an example, you most likely aren’t going to want the best-of-the-best in relation to suction.
